Job Description

Category Schools - CNA Nurse Job Type Contract Bring your passion for student support to a fulfilling contract position near Manchester, NH, as a Certified Nurse Assistant (CNA) or Licensed Nursing Assistant (LNA). You'll work 1:1 with students across various caseloads in a full-time capacity, providing essential care, compassion, and collaboration within a vibrant school environment. Your active LNA license is required for this role, with openings available for skilled professionals ready to make a difference. Assignments may involve bus riding, ensuring safety and care during student transport as well as throughout the school day. You'll have the unique chance to support students' medical and academic needs, creating a positive impact every day. We're seeking compassionate, adaptable CNA/LNAs comfortable working with a variety of medical needs. Please share your preferences regarding trach care, G-tube, vent support, seizure monitoring, diabetic care, toileting assistance, bus riding, and willingness to assist students academically.
Desired Qualifications:
Active LNA license in New Hampshire Current CNA certification and experience working with pediatric or school-aged populations Capacity to work full-time on a contract basis Willingness to participate in bus riding as needed Strong interpersonal skills and ability to build supportive relationships Collaborative approach to working with school staff, students, and families
Key Responsibilities:
Provide direct 1:1 personal and medical care to assigned students Support functional and academic goals as needed during the school day Communicate promptly and effectively with the school healthcare team Ensure safe supervision during transit if assigned to a bus route Adhere to individualized care plans and document care provided Ready to make a difference in a student's school experience?
